8(7(uYHJBaSX
z#@(HgQSWb3z(SyHg_hCByT+XoLA}P>YFC(fKjqV@(~63ULds1>oI)<+eJINFxsDQg
zZ)a!cBjeFdmM#w89UhogR}jbYjK3Rvs&3@fpVp$7wNu93MZ*CcEpf8CZtQI@@6iU?
z+1<)6wj)-_-!+AV8fz6oz0W&|Nf24g(Eh5qc9^C|jNGGwAA3DVY{R7Cz;5iPszEHf
zX&x;=$bVAihZ>TAU%CZ+vn&Je+u!m%2Y2Wc_`GWrTL0`J2GKWd#raM!d^B4+gC>fG
zr2wa;Lk0dZFvGJ`GYN2}-)E4HakvxVHkUuf%9oM?mT`IAOD0k}1iYgsb?ZoM@KmxX
zaDn03H;lzH>g*MQoR3C(OO_(yg=c2CXb7z3!*i)Y+Wd4z?l73bbkg-ZL*%uz#YN}k
z27|#~{#WRs$tEz15T#yObwI0dOOfyI+|Om{`gGFQQ&^uG#fSAmUa0JvV2DZ1=2Hhwb0`HLDL7
zN?yN#Q!L#-S$1vS3yZYLsZorX9xESJ%+zHccYwj<2Rm)mnz~ih)PmD;GXa@re%?>Y
z_uU+mBIe;k
zMG=c?T-}avTXOUcvKaF(iaePKL@FF^pT(}aP6Q!~u?R_KN#ya%-MXMI;Tq*B^S2@v
zE;*3)9IXQqNkm&?(1C!|rP8Qf(V9zS&S*e{`Mx{_JqMmZX|b?~!J7Js5+=;H52G7V
za~On_IP{G?FXhYs_D3fI*{nz0-;b@loDXMW1rB${n%|8%wH{IuuDS@j)B
zgD^dBGjY@mu*s7f5QNtu>`Ex_EsyeucV5uWG;AoFF+iCy_e6~&&Dq;HRl1$_m)(v{
zthvh&gZMXgxSpen69%#Gr`nur)%U7UsN34oUH7!oUc*nz*0}vvoYbdgaL0JR-3PtqkHBQO$Kg^(=3Xb&}nNf&pzn06s>YD}8cyfR()Wdv%esC~M=Gr!JXo
z;r6Ce61BX%{7cu~lK;BxsH?udel90d)4?&shCiopmE;%my@J;1w)153O8IknDWHnS
zmjE&L7UA67+=EkVW$jV079Osp4doW|zXILD;O5V_*(y_V&V})F8A@+Ue_u4DEq{6u
z#=4~uALT+B$`9H4!F9Lcolw#w#m&E5s3X3A7I1f~yV=CJ`_AgWID;ou^!~HxqjYx*X>lYb
zK=ksuR~mHA}?qS4`);ABU
zt*>l1oX6oDaPZgz^Y<&5zJTr|F5vY6kLd3nKQ_HJRfG6-j%0g)aPHi`@`D3mo$|qU
zxd+Y41Do!a=&k12m6%l@OB{RYp)$m^o+Dzd+5IZSC8_()ojVPIztZbE7rY5ih6!
zs~{P1q98u`5S?GxE`;ckm5EcFYu3;vuW9{k?;Z~#;PH6phKWu7y`NQjJNSHk4ZU=`
z*W=L}@`J_6+>vaj&ISD9Ln9m3oBGwf>gS#=*>rZU)Bk}rsUOV^Bsa{4AMnqdzxzT|
z?sr^fW@cb*UHoS~jn=&o^q)F@ZjuSDb7yU``Onpx?~nKqQ-gTCHH$QD;$nP!ytUBW
zjrpt^RBvm-XDyB978{2>LS1S(NZ`3-SCJ47JWHs!ZW1027!*VaYTW~Rxr*Dq(qAG0
z6HO{$4VEmVhXd<_Hm!*N;Eo!Q^8QlL*l`*-CJcj_>S-b7n82iR*a+=%%T0<
z-1Lgj05=UBNV8xnqeA4=!f{d>L|$Jjc#Q|ZL^12GCUG#Lk}g)@%vhoQ9hT)c@Gu-0
zc=}QB88aj5HluO#oHl4lOiN4q+SJ&%<6LeNEfKP?TQWaCzpz2r*H2I)5G^b$zH*3!
zMm*MVQ_i01*&U4TZDh0l>DT-s+=g#m*K07;z>qWNAWuV0ZSVN=UE9dC0c6O@q!tCs
znE?@d!hT{C>LP(o5D6L(P0jsX%A#(W$mIrTWLEzqcO-_Zog!EcLbLj
z3xY>nk!ez>&l;4mzi9_wz1K36K$Te;-NrFH-oT5EWAtoG1?u#6pT?4Is_$~$e&z%I
zD6AOr9XZ5R1^#_x9$6neB5rl5OA@v5Iy$2?6UNxT{@$W&`%jm)<>UoD+UwWap@-GU
z=G$mCUTTQDy$Z^c77Lb-%=RVxwOIQTa6?|65~dZO@U=ax9p`Ptr9w*qIfT#e%gP|E
zyIFt#Da1~7?*hv+GF)RRJt{zvXa$2sb0Ls6+oTE(Be1k&kjSSsaNj_a
z8fnSrz=MRsBZ;KwWk8u^_+GN0K;opF&~lE146c~*;gZfkTrLi{N<%0pL%HXPS0I;H
zq{_U_wIBoPrMO~4$dk3@{6Z>}aI{VCLuh_PT8sQYc*=8O=^pe;6tWWQ`!gUtH|_}T
zLQ&f*iMc1rLsZ`DxUCVW0Cv(F@5<3s2*z_2Ppszga|eI)3U)t5U_^@zXRt9&WS_c>
zeQV>ktV46GaaQ7I3;ijoJ=uT1BWpm@I6*SGK4wCdtN8Obe1rT>Q%Q-q*sa;xGWRY_
z$Mu@;*s*UI7oSm_b8}+_R3pG6?)gPOTJn1ZXjRr7CwlqqP@Ds+IqoF3(&==<`+Ifw
z(7?4DL#Kkvw|4~cJqbA6cJt-!=z_?!nJ$LAI^wZt&)F(*r(Jg?IF<+N{NwlmuUv)bO}9e
zfZg0}`6lN(QJOu|n$EA>iZi_h%G{?r?3fk%UM1M7@7Ij?m`G
zJlVjuk55~WU0la7o$jqzMnGB{_3P!E!6EtnCufN8Re=gg)Dsiys~)b(@>=Ozy$5y_
z+5Xly#C~gLTNs;Rmyyhuk8UtzrtCyZ@r*nd>>&tA
zuVJRveUBYs(~V`^xCIDcbS~}aD&^=ZORzExS6mi^d)!UCq$D_^@Z(cr`o-na&2zWK
zl;pi~w$rA8MF;v3(UL#B;i5BtV{3_%?%M(z{Wb=U!_BG!X2KsG4c!i5M$}9~YfwD2
z&_6058IJr1Q(BnU`>fRUA$jYVNt7%?i|+bst5&`L1An+8fy;(dju;sjj*gCXOS(WO
fNcg`;M1|r
zWF!1st^zx8wh2AErKjiBHrq{kJ5?b~D?gYRI;kOX@0kF>TSZF8y(~T|(1EUAmNk=J
z(i&n|$OZ`hrs)g`k|1-Ck!Alxr5g|swh?W?C2yk=5-?XcIJ@KjQ9Oc=Xb%J`XV;T}
zHr=P^qmx;9$;sdTC?D;ve*B)1k#TWpbz)+IwW}#&`fs>UwlNS)F`f;UW#+Ae^v!3>
zIi1`2ceuB=R~WOAS)X4};J5qg53(T6^_Q*xPOh02gbfdDw3DE(0pq2)!-D+%{cAqv
zNeTu`N5`-)+4X&gQO(+wg!sv_NV6BWqfE~G7Gqek^tF=2-uSJ!WF-!mwV*?(Zn+zV
z6F#e5bn4(eNO-~q7ZP>1Cj2X1r0k*?m{Zb+8CHI2UE`ZRGH9b&vT3BNg3!A4gs$!I
zH-8QM*`k;9Li+W=rDe~@D$1;DD*Caf_K)Fbepz%m7PAJ5HN|z@Oz}RWqHZt_b$d{Q
zM3KIU>C-a@0~JYxu6DIe@Acvcqf1=!D7$aO!so7wQ^Q25CKX&6?J1kgtFaj@VTm@r
ztWvSq6*;V=`=MW%=1`mxV2M6zti^j{w9Oon%E
z!pyZis?dQ5w|O@-*9iuKHeSuBvOt=nGJdJV{>zJ`{?NCr&G^;
zhm*to?M}x?GHv?UVCkJ;$y?^jSNoT#k%S1Fwl5i0}uqMdhWyHR4snC0+l8rVDXDP`+haT3b!_!mToHHXkqc|`kA1MuqetT5sa
zgiX=-3qCXm8YvZ0yAwHAMrayxy(7mhcf08n)6!rch>#O7aZ5JhOWsTIS!DqXFVQx~+(Nt9LY03>b=ZY=aXF&LI(e{#?DE{0cu2}iBVu}N1&Hg`65@0BTpY~+YQM}i6&@H-L0`E7&>GH-$b9If
z)?4AT2d1SXfanR>JNBBW%zlY+w6O0xpXS`A{>|u1Ndx$-j<1;l}rSK(M21T{7a?;Opa}p*X8?#*@t>>eRw{}
z=(jxgJ-1AzCS6jEG}z7t$atPdw(HRVB}R5T9K8G6cJyoe0)qMyED!tLEY;A?;MkcV
zewX*6NR44H5(qGna-mn`h^pyarI?zVf4cGq{aO;J7`k=&EnPpDeMFL-E0xp1;+1b(
z1HvJbF-_G1y
zS+{nls7y{^6foumjjY?MX%AkPPrTvwyg_jDf+~r0Y3x~B5B(|oT+I#Cu@VZ6AZ&-V
zJj&5wo95~|cRKQ2{NFJgkOX`LVChEMs~5u}yf+g#&T|1{q1egWU_p)S^kJ)f7pAAb
z)k$}W!~ys368Onx5ke^pWo&F5S*;Z_QDI#0JpHB`RJtws42ekyH?2}_%r3hsi@GMe
zqvl8;omUDI+}{w^IekI&xO3P}S!#1wC{i9kxk-B=LaL;mhU$2aSt?D9Nv4BzICB3L
zY!!0RDxg_?eON$30*a+823w-__O%)2NHhpZ>1t$Xz2bBq(h_+l&J}Dof)u)W%oV7V
zH0j@c=c$mzn17*d+!ECo0w%HbO`J^>6CLW1*TA&f*;wy~AIJs)q
zCKCl}0Z=e3PZ~ge-0~tPJLFtIJ*Ez4d~4eh}9z>$GFjtSwtj~N4Ip$qQs9D!iPqNF_$
zkFC+s(ZG>I%?0Fwc1UPwXi)^Vd&WZ>?%~u7%pJk59DYnoOFQjm5hb@P4rX#{3jTd~
z82;?2cdNH?Cg?E+2sX7QYIJT<6Ctp!HKVV7^-qLaCPNNeU;R3B=w-@48&maQ0W;>b
zW95Yl5}gLWD4QgIE9JS)D!+WJWrf
zWx!<~iNkTC$Y%lY@V4Os#c*CxztMUEiY{3t%9RWl$GIn&2;r&K^H6ksr$O?so2erE
zPdzb;UaxngGL}_6a=p7~%Sb(jKYDJ>>9!1qb1y&J#kCIZ2W1&NYHX^EXyC&%+>%$S5MY@CZFvN|9xRtIS}f0kquw!&p^7%m*0F2
z3C!5+iCFpO`iFW``p-92t_ha==J&D)9f2(dgq_W{XgyJPAC1*|$g2yFQ
zZ;mgbav|c0Fv@GT!Nuh3eAS)TGoYoU1rWNRrSLe+=T6^HdoeDxQmHj`DsO?AyuyD4
z8$(*8)9Lo^X?**Ua|;WRDuSksCW@%I*m7PJ;it#EJTE6UbwlH9ul$ldo^kkiy05|t
z{o~4JOu1e6(^-p#xmKWLMT>!LAqeUgWfYM0T2fvCwZy+dslgdy#_C>@&e^-Kosf;da!-!+2l7u{Qd$oTmV$}et1S{XaHi{7i{
zrb{_vI=t`AviLB5@PGW&
zh34)SI731uOqdXH@B5lp1##qar`94z!qbv}2Ua;vNrCV_YM0g3)t}VcIZ(M+p62H}
z4tz>jH@o&)3N-Td>(?(Z?Q7_MRmVKlC)Vsg>*gmW%qFK^nTCc-38S3a`D~0@ICLfw
zwPJ=~?4o6ILAIG`2FnB{GHUmWpQzP&jk>_cWv#o%?h@D!Ydz-N;pRJW%UML;7t=CT
zI6aI@y&E<~9(x5zu-aOL8
z;4`|e)`+TIh@3jOc#9C@#A{FQp#>;l=m>>c0&`W+<2do?MJh35I{?PdYhCh`K~pYz
zJExD)&W8(_=@FCE<$gSMA;rGheQX-*+9^j6HT>9X-*%@}WFQc*WS{qgvOW_j@n9F1
zY^>zZg_PF^Z+VoiiBfc`?mnKn9R^rp=7?GUbyL~*bw!)Px>Wmd;e9M{d}O3K>MpZ;
zO7*Z)cX$FP(L_u0`9n~L;%L3kuGFmq6qLLkp}ueyf=*5zpQvHnk#j$}UbZGl`g5C6
zijBsXxdUZbU=S&sA@!k1Pvl7|r=`2bm`;?!Mc{7Kx9rX&aKDm)sMe&pfu^R}y}F>j
zx<3|qIl#&c+?B96`HmcpO9x+eD(wXkjKUR7%~Ttl?rv_Q1~+po
zOWKR^?-J1uSzilp;c$`IG!)NB*(`Myw{Ny_E~C)my>8
z2Se;W>H&)UYq7-wwIOSbJZt08X59hm5M85M6&wyX9<%(((g+G8xV;$xpk3=8CUd|2
z`PU3%CJk+(S8+$gc7LdE-oY6{VTL!{$bd$xW|ing?Nd2!zWPUb!P1EEGwjUM8yg#c
zHQ$fkY2PX($tw;xj<3M(atn^rmd2{M$;JTJNp2iFDWg9s{tn6Cqge19k~c8IjzG8b
z#~0hu-ta=A<#KFO6eccbs|;Zh1I{zY>U#ERdY8V(2gu-kV_fBzFQhMi
zBl%*C3W%+GB&DQ}xF!NQZzTEkeMB08nrLqN287@*k?40{AQTf(zx$B{)*rF{hX_IH
z?*$)#Fe7gn7-kjMdyfl&&^3AgQu)>Q(ub=Z$K&eE>x_FvX`dZBaC5Ll-4h>gO_S?$61xzluV0$0&;f!<806w$?7i{E4L<_4L9{PS@0
z;k(KwBxFGEozEdxpN-K#{q~tSLMe~gg|1|yc(>-*Cn+MsdFA!vkvq*6aW*ft9B#70
zvcQ~J%D7c)LkrF49*|-l;IURK1%AN)Mid>&m#uVZ&(3U_rkmOtNQK7ggAzpG+U1Gp
zn~y~<$Mz5kVLz|16k6!3na`yi9E5et8$a1LqB1k>lVb73>u9oP;`_rZ@YHO>3M5M*
zVJ|Edoqi2FcHg#4qq`If(7w$Mm&zOirZQ)B=&Mcs8gl^@H6ig7dyucF-t&B8j<;Gs
z!>YGj>Lk%MzN4nfk@40b0?A|<0MCxh(AwJB8TghLCdb8*zN#U{#w#i3A;WprQp{BW
zsvVgJ4w~Os7Mo(}lR=H7=G$a2MY}j~G!A7mx8NkP@*6(tePmtej&q4-zVU9|-hoJ5O@cwMGl1)C!WKXxe>2XQ^?I`yD7CD{z
zaK>S(-o*k8t6OA65w9uGkhZAwd8xA-q+eK>qPw*Hd4tu~**
z8&FBtezs3n)X;}`Wt>HN$*x}(>HTwivdnII@fT-V>>?)Lygh{8(CTGj_0$_!lrD>&
zF$${JDG|F0Zp)GUSSOi90dM(u8Cle!r$
zh0V^Do27(nfAC{jQYz3z?^6z9sC%dJN+KT;GOlszZt`UMOw=Kit#2*@z`1*hZP=?R
z2BJfYQ=kutP;~CJn2cvTI=n(z>w^%I-P!(Pp6MkDcqCIlsQuzwK=Iga`4l*MH9=f`
zTI`d!bg}*WTp)I$h<=Kl_fzkqHID@T-Y6b^HOsco5Kd_(({FD{X8WkXO`7|(
zkLxx>r7^;lby*t#(NE-DnJOEGj7bJ5KIoPU-}v}ds(X)I63qbe2|F{;HT#y?@yNS}{6_&&&L$Nt
zno$R7EMCW|C^&I(H9jY3Typs-{JL%~%w2Uta)rx%;Cz=Uqn4nE93|mS-rKUaM!vTd)N$
z;$D8xjv8wi`a)C44SrQb0*)4~JTi3Vkofp2<^~Yfbp122sJHx&x;vvnapSo+dl_k0
zsMJ8;B^eoeXy{J=*5N-+OuK5Wfzl@jt||Xq38;u>aJy)i9xJZA{5Qm8HrT6h$yxgH
zr?91v1$hV$V59-M?IGO8h{?wNT*KQIr@J@U|~xD
literal 0
HcmV?d00001
diff --git a/static/setting.png b/static/consumer/setting.png
similarity index 100%
rename from static/setting.png
rename to static/consumer/setting.png
diff --git a/static/images/default-banner.png b/static/images/default-banner.png
deleted file mode 100644
index e69de29b..00000000
diff --git a/static/images/default-product.png b/static/images/default-product.png
deleted file mode 100644
index e69de29b..00000000
diff --git a/utils/orderStatus.uts b/utils/orderStatus.uts
index 55619afa..1a6ccf51 100644
--- a/utils/orderStatus.uts
+++ b/utils/orderStatus.uts
@@ -136,9 +136,12 @@ export function getOrderDisplayStatus(order: OrderStatusSource): string {
if (displayState == 'pending_pay') {
return 'pending'
}
- if (displayState == 'cancelled' || displayState == 'expired') {
+ if (displayState == 'cancelled') {
return 'cancelled'
}
+ if (displayState == 'expired') {
+ return 'expired'
+ }
if (displayState == 'processing') {
return 'shipping'
}
@@ -169,4 +172,4 @@ export function formatCountdownHMS(seconds: number): string {
const minutes = Math.floor((safeSeconds % 3600) / 60)
const remainSeconds = safeSeconds % 60
return pad2(hours) + ':' + pad2(minutes) + ':' + pad2(remainSeconds)
-}
\ No newline at end of file
+}